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al Cost in Minerva Park, OH

The cost of hydrostatic pressure water removal in Minerva Park, OH,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$1,000 to $5,000, but the exact cost will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to ensure you get the best possible price for the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and complexity of the job.
Water Removal $1,000 – $3,000 Amount of water, equipment used, and labor required.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 – $4,000 Size of affected area, equipment used, and labor required.
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$6,000 Complexity of the job, materials required, and labor involved.
Free On-Site Assessment $0 – $0 Free estimates are available for all services.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average prices and can v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a detailed estimate after assessing your home.

How Do I Prevent Hydrostatic Pressure Water Damage in the Future?

Regular maintenance is key to preventing hydrostatic pressure water damage. Check your home’s gutters and downspouts, ensure proper grading, and keep an eye out for any signs of water damage.
